Understanding Humidity and Its Importance
Humidity is the amount of moisture present in the air. For houseplants, humidity levels can greatly influence their growth, health, and overall well-being. Most houseplants thrive in a humidity range between 40% to 60%, although some tropical varieties prefer higher humidity levels of up to 80%.
Effects of Low Humidity
Low humidity can lead to various issues for houseplants:
- Brown Leaf Edges: One of the first signs of low humidity is browning leaf edges, which can be unsightly and indicate stress on the plant.
- Leaf Drop: Many plants will shed leaves when they are not getting enough moisture in the air. This is a survival mechanism.
- Pest Infestations: Pests like spider mites thrive in dry conditions. Low humidity creates an ideal breeding ground for these unwanted guests.
- Stunted Growth: Plants may become sluggish and fail to grow properly if they do not have enough humidity.
Effects of High Humidity
Conversely, excessively high humidity can also pose challenges:
- Fungal Diseases: High humidity creates a favorable environment for fungal diseases such as root rot and powdery mildew.
- Bacterial Issues: Bacteria thrive in moist conditions, potentially harming plant health and causing decay.
- Poor Air Circulation: Excessive moisture can lead to stagnation in air circulation around plants, which can hinder growth.
Balancing indoor humidity is essential to ensure that your houseplants remain healthy and vibrant.
Assessing Current Humidity Levels
Before taking steps to adjust humidity, it’s vital to understand your starting point. You can assess indoor humidity levels using a hygrometer—an instrument designed to measure moisture in the air. Hygrometers are available in both analog and digital formats and are widely accessible from gardening stores or online retailers.
Ideal Humidity Levels
As mentioned earlier, most houseplants do best within the 40% to 60% range. Here’s a quick breakdown of some common houseplants and their preferred humidity levels:
- Succulents & Cacti: 30% – 40%
- Fiddle Leaf Fig: 50% – 60%
- Orchids: 50% – 70%
- Boston Ferns: 60% – 80%
It’s essential to research specific requirements for each type of plant you own.
Tips for Balancing Indoor Humidity
Once you’ve assessed your indoor humidity levels, here are several strategies to help you maintain optimal humidity for your houseplants:
1. Use a Humidifier
One of the most effective ways to increase humidity is through the use of a humidifier. These devices release water vapor into the air, creating a more humid environment perfect for tropical plants. When selecting a humidifier:
- Choose one with adjustable settings so you can control moisture levels effectively.
- Consider placing it near groups of plants that require similar humidity levels.
- Regularly clean your humidifier to prevent mold and bacteria buildup.
2. Group Plants Together
Plants naturally transpire; they release water vapor into the air through their leaves. By grouping plants together, you create a microenvironment where increased moisture accumulates around them. This method works particularly well with plants that thrive in similar conditions.
3. Utilize Pebble Trays
For those who prefer a more natural approach, pebble trays can be an excellent solution. Fill a shallow tray with pebbles and add water until it just touches the bottom of the pots without submerging them. As the water evaporates, it increases the surrounding humidity.
4. Mist Regularly
Light misting can temporarily raise humidity levels around individual plants. However, it’s essential not to overdo it:
- Mist early in the day so that foliage has time to dry before evening.
- Use distilled water if possible, as tap water may leave mineral deposits on leaves.
- Avoid misting plants with fuzzy leaves (like African violets), as this can encourage rot.
5. Create Microclimates with Plastic Bags
For particularly finicky plants or seedlings, consider creating a mini greenhouse effect using plastic bags:
- Place clear plastic bags loosely over plants or groups of plants.
- Ensure they don’t touch any foliage directly; this could cause rot.
- Monitor regularly for signs of condensation inside the bag—if it gets too moist, remove it briefly to allow air circulation.
6. Optimize Your Home’s Heating System
Central heating often strips moisture from indoor air during colder months. To combat this:
- Place bowls of water near heating vents; as the water evaporates, it adds moisture back into the air.
- Use radiator humidifiers—small devices that attach directly to radiators, helping maintain consistent moisture levels.
7. Ventilation Matters
While increasing humidity is essential, ensuring adequate ventilation is equally critical:
- Open windows when weather permits; fresh air helps prevent stagnant conditions conducive to mold and pests.
- Use fans if necessary to promote airflow without creating drafts that could damage sensitive plants.
8. Watering Techniques
Watering methods also impact indoor humidity:
- Water more frequently during dry seasons but ensure pots have good drainage.
- Avoid letting water sit at the base of pots as this can lead to root rot.
Monitoring Plant Health
After implementing these changes, keep an eye on your plants’ health over time. Watch for signs of stress or improvement in growth patterns. Adjust strategies as needed based on seasonal changes or particular plant needs.
Signs Your Plants Are Thriving
Healthy foliage color and growth are good indicators that you’ve achieved balanced humidity levels:
- Leaves should be vibrant in color without browning or curling.
- New growth should appear regularly.
- Flowers or blooms (if applicable) should thrive during their respective seasons.
